Strategies for
Seamless Policyholder Onboarding with
Automated Payments
First impressions
matter, especially in insurance. When a new
policyholder signs up, every step of the
onboarding experience sends a message. A clunky
payment setup process? That tells them to expect
outdated systems and poor communication
down the line.
For carriers, MGAs, and TPAs, onboarding isn't
just about capturing signatures and issuing
policy documents. It's the gateway to long-term
retention, recurring revenue, and operational
efficiency. And yet, payment onboarding, the
moment when a customer sets
up how they'll pay and be paid, is often riddled
with manual steps, compliance gaps, and
unnecessary friction.
Let's break down what's holding onboarding back
and how automation can turn it into a growth
advantage.
The Hidden Cost
of Manual Payment
Onboarding
Disjointed
Workflows
Too often, payment details are captured through
separate systems, emails, or forms, not
integrated with core onboarding tools. That
disjointedness creates downstream issues, from
reconciliation delays to compliance gaps.
Delayed First
Payments
When there's lag between policy issuance and
payment method verification, it creates cash
flow risk. Unverified payment data can result in
failed debits, delayed claims reimbursements, or
frustrated customers.
Regulatory
Vulnerabilities
Manually collecting banking or card info without
secure protocols exposes your business to PCI
compliance issues, fraud risk, and audit pain.
What
Modern Onboarding Looks Like
Forward-thinking
organizations are reengineering onboarding to
include fully embedded, automated payment flows.
Here's what that looks like in action:
Integrated Payment Capture at
Signup
As soon as a policy is issued, the payment
method--ACH, card, or digital wallet--is
securely collected and tokenized. No
handoffs, no delays.
Instant Verification & Recurring
Setup
Payment credentials are verified in real
time, and recurring billing is enabled
immediately. No waiting, no follow-up
forms.
Smart Disbursement
Preferences
Policyholders can choose how they'd like to
receive claim reimbursements or premium
refunds from day one via direct deposit,
card push, or digital wallet.
Automated Compliance &
Reporting
KYC and AML checks happen in the background,
reducing staff workload and ensuring that
onboarding stays audit-ready.
Real Results From
Payment-First Onboarding
Organizations that lead
with automated payment onboarding see measurable
improvements:
Faster Policy Activation:
Reduced time from quote to bound policy
Lower NIGO Rates: Fewer
"not in good order" issues on payment
forms
Stronger Retention:
Seamless payments mean fewer missed
renewals
Reduced Support Tickets:
Fewer billing-related service calls
in the first 90 days
